Transaction 835995321b3edaa54e1c2db544058ea8d4f3107c88c1a3c5ab16b43693950797
1 Input
1 Output
-
835995321b3edaa54e1c2db544058ea8d4f3107c88c1a3c5ab16b43693950797:0
- value
- 179632046
- script pubkey
- OP_0 OP_PUSHBYTES_20 e34c2c9391eafd610290ac7e1258dabcfcd466ff
- address
- bc1qudxzeyu3at7kzq5s43lpykx6hn7dgehlu3et52